Responsibility
- Inspect and evaluate raw materials, in-process components, and finished precast products against industry standards, engineering blueprints, and client specifications.
- Conduct thorough visual, dimensional, and functional tests to identify defects, deviations, or non-conformities.
- Document inspection results, including detailed reports, non-conformance records, and corrective action recommendations.
- Collaborate with production, engineering, and project teams to address quality issues and implement continuous improvement initiatives.
- Ensure compliance with local and international quality standards, such as ISO, ASTM, or other relevant construction regulations.
- Perform regular calibration and maintenance of inspection tools and equipment to ensure accuracy and reliability.
- Participate in pre-production meetings to review quality control plans and inspection criteria for new projects.
- Train and mentor junior staff or production teams on quality control procedures and best practices.
Qualifications
- Diploma or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field.
- Minimum 3 years of experience in quality control, preferably in the precast concrete or construction industry.
- Strong knowledge of quality control standards (e.g., ISO 9001, ASTM, ACI) and construction regulations.
- Proficient in reading and interpreting engineering drawings, blueprints, and technical specifications.
- Excellent attention to detail and analytical skills to identify defects and propose solutions.
- Familiarity with inspection tools (e.g., calipers, micrometers, ultrasonic testers) and quality management software.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
- Certification in Quality Control or Six Sigma is a plus.
